Is there anyway to call a group of extensions at once or in a specific order and then play a simple recorded message back to them?

Basically we have an operator who has to call the same extensions at certain times of the day, but instead of them having to dial each seperately, speaking the same message, then hanging up, they have asked if there was a way to do this automatically i.e they record a message somewhere, then the system calls each extension and plays back the pre-recorded message.

Create a group page, with the extensions you want to call. make the call to the group, then conference in the announcement number you want to play.

Voila!!! All extensions get answered and the pre-recorded announcement plays.

Ok, I have setup a group in "GROUP PAGING USING SPEAKERPHONE" and a "grp-page" button on my phone, which seems to work i.e. each phone screen shows the relevant page and the speaker buton is on, but they cannot hear anything??

Any ideas why not?

As long as I know group-page work in one way only... just as an overhead page but using the speakerphone.
 
Make sure that the "speakerphone" setting on page 1 of the station is set correctly. What phone type are you using?

Thanks for all you help, I have found the issue was the COR on the group page, once it was changed matched the appropriate level it works fine.
